    Malott’s Triumphant TKO: A Night of Thrilling Battles at UFC Winnipeg

    Winnipeg, Canada (April 19th, 2026) — The octagon was alight with intensity as UFC Fight Night 273 unfolded in Winnipeg, Canada, on April 18, 2026. The event was headlined by a spectacular showdown between Canadian rising star Mike Malott and seasoned veteran Gilbert Burns, culminating in a night of unforgettable fights and emotional moments.

    The main event saw Mike Malott deliver a stunning third-round TKO victory over Gilbert Burns, a former title challenger. This pivotal moment marked a significant shift in the welterweight division and left fans in awe of Malott’s prowess. Following the defeat, Burns announced his retirement, bringing an end to an illustrious career that has left an indelible mark on the sport.

    The night was filled with remarkable performances, and the UFC recognized the standout athletes with generous bonuses. Charles Jourdain and Kyler Phillips were awarded the Fight of the Night, each receiving $100,000 for their thrilling bout. Mike Malott and Márcio Barbosa took home Performance of the Night honors, also earning $100,000 each. Additionally, Jai Herbert, Robert Valentin, Gokhan Saricam, and John Yannis were each granted $25,000 finish bonuses for their impressive victories.

    The main card was a rollercoaster of excitement. In the welterweight division, Mike Malott’s triumph over Gilbert Burns was a testament to his skill and determination. The bantamweight bout between Charles Jourdain and Kyler Phillips kept fans on the edge of their seats, with Jourdain securing a unanimous decision victory. Jai Herbert dominated Mandel Nallo in the lightweight division with a first-round TKO, while Jasmine Jasudavicius outclassed Karine Silva in the women’s flyweight category, winning by unanimous decision. The lightweight clash between Thiago Moisés and Gauge Young ended in a split decision, with Moisés emerging victorious.

    The preliminary card set the stage for the main event with a series of impressive performances. Márcio Barbosa’s first-round KO of Dennis Buzukja was a highlight, showcasing his striking prowess. Robert Valentin’s submission victory over Julien LeBlanc demonstrated his grappling expertise, while Gokhan Saricam’s second-round TKO of Tanner Boser was a display of sheer power. Melissa Croden and JJ Aldrich both secured unanimous decision victories in their respective bouts, and the catchweight contest between John Castaneda and Mark Vologdin ended in a majority draw. John Yannis rounded out the preliminary card with a first-round TKO win over Jamie Siraj.
